With its proximity to railway station, bus stand and prominent tourist attractions of the city, Hotel Padmini Palace has become one of the preferred choices of budget travellers visiting Udaipur. It houses 20 rooms, available in different categories−standard room, deluxe room and super deluxe room. For a hassle-free stay, amenities like television, sofa, air-conditioner and cable television are provided in all rooms. Upon request, the hotel offers airport/railway station pick-up services and tour assistance, besides essential services like doctor on call, power backup, currency exchange, car rental and room service. Enjoy panoramic views of the city from the in-house Jharokha restaurant, which serves scrumptious dishes.
